Discussion Part I: Limitations and Challenges
From providing ongoing assessments to monitoring for complications and facilitating recovery, advanced practice nurses who care for patients in perioperative environments experience a unique set of limitations and challenges. Reflecting on your experiences in this complex and critical environment will help you develop your professional competency and prepare you for your future role as an advanced practice nurse. In this week’s Discussion, you consider limitations and challenges of clinical practice in perioperative care settings.
To prepare:
Reflect on this week’s clinical experiences.
Consider one limitation or challenge you encountered.
Think about how you overcame this limitation or challenge and how this might affect your future practice in pre- and post-operative care settings.
Post on or before Day 3 a description of at least one limitation or challenge you encountered during your clinical experience this week. Explain how you overcame this limitation or challenge and how this might affect your future practice.
Note: If you refer to a patient in your Discussions or Assignments, be sure to use a pseudonym or other false form of identification. This is to ensure the privacy and protection of the patient.
Read a selection of your colleagues’ responses.
Respond on or before Day 6 to two colleagues by sharing additional insights or alternative perspectives.
